    Johnathan L.

    So it is pretty affordable we'll say, but I think that the Ramen quality could definitely improve but for the price can really complain. I think it's about $12 for a bowl at lunch which compared to today's prices the other Ramen shops is a steal. The Ramen itself was not bad. It had a lot of soy and miso notes, but I didn't have that much creaminess like typical Japanese Ramen. It was actually more Chinese style than I thought. They also put a lot of Napa cabbage in the noodles to fill the bowl up; I wasn't a huge fan since I'd rather have more noodles, but I think it comes to personal preference. The best part about the dish was definitely the egg I really liked the goose. It was perfectly salted comparable to other Ramen shops and it was also very jammy in the center. I would say for the area this r/'en shop is OK but in comparison to all the Ramen shops, I've tried being up in Maryland and nova I think that this one is probably below par than what I usually have. The service was pretty fast I would say and they were very quick to get my bowl out, probably within five minutes.

    Shawn C.

    Came for dinner on a weekday and noticed the inside is a quiet and clean place. Seems like ample seating. Works were friendly and attentive, kept things running smoothly. Ordered the agedashi tofu and the katsu ramen. The tofu was lightly battered/fried and the sauce was the right flavor, but it was way too salty. I appreciate the generous helping of sauce, but I think it's too much for agedashi tofu. The ramen was also disappointing. The katsu pieces were minimal, there was too little broth and it wasn't very rich or flavorful. The noodles were cooked right though.
